Wind was light that night out of the E. 1st day of light east wind since a full week of SW the fish have been here but now I don't know. It's a hike I say. K9's reply " I am up to it". Water was cleaner than I expected. It is going to be all about presentation tonight, make sure you are on your game, with water this clear these fish will have you talking to your self. See those rocks? Cast around them. He was trying for a while with no real hookups. What are you using I ask him. Here try this. Fish it with slight jerks of the rod tip and go SLOW. A lot of the school moved out with the wind change but the bigger ones definitely hung around. They were finicky until the tide really started to drop. But I attribute the finicky-ness as to what he was throwing at first. We never did change our plugs that night, never needed to. I am not sure if Brian aka. "K9" has since.
